All notable changes to this project will be documented in this file.
The format is based on Keep a Changelog and this project adheres to Semantic Versioning.
- Mechanism to resolve absolute paths in include directives
- Mechanism to follow include directives to find all declared taglibs
- More screenshots
- Syntax Error (Only relevant for a future Atom version with a new Babel configuration)
- Completion for tags, attributes and attribute values
- Specs for tag, attribute and attribute value completion
- Problem with new lines in method signatures from
.tld
files
- Favor variables from
<c:useBean>
tags over vars from<c:set>
tags
- README
- Only show autocompletion from imported taglibs. Taglibs can be imported with:
- The taglib directive (
<%@ taglib uri="uri" prefix="tagPrefix" >
) - The XML equivalent of the taglib directive (
<jsp:directive.taglib uri="uri" prefix="tagPrefix" />
) - As XML namespace (
<jsp:root xmlns:tagPrefix="uri">
)
- The taglib directive (
- Use dynamic prefix for EL-Functions. Previously the
short-name
from the taglib was used, now the prefix from the taglib directive is used.
- Only show autocompletion if the prefix is longer or equal then the
autocomplete-plus.minimumWordLength
configuration or the autocompletion was triggered byautocomplete-plus:activate
(Ctrl-Space)
- A label with the full name for keyword e.g.
less or equal
foreq
- Specs for the EL-provider
No changes
- Bug with the recognition of variables defined in tags
- Autocompletion for references to objects imported by
<jsp:useBean>
tags
- Screenshots
- The TLD files are now loaded completely async
- Problems with mixed case EL functions
- Bug when loading TLDs from a folder that contained other files as well
- Bug with underscores in package or class names
- Mechanism to load TLFs from a directories specified by the configuration
- Autocompletion for variables defined in tags such as
<c:set var"foo" value="bar"/>
- Basic autocompletion for tag functions
- Autocompletion for implicit objects